I would like to have a Cavalier & Fighter character & use boon companion. Has any one worked this out?
As far as I can tell, the cavalier's mount functions as a druid's animal companion. Therefore, "Boon Companion" should apply.
Boon Companion is worded a bit oddly, but the intent of the feat is similar to the "Natural Bond" feat from 3.5. Basically, you add 4 to your effective druid level, up to a maximum of your character level.
A Cavalier 1/Fighter 4 with Boon Companion would be treated as a Druid 5 for the purpose of the Animal Companion.
A Cavalier 1/Fighter 1 with Boon Companion would be treated as a Druid 2.
A Cavalier 2/Fighter 3 would be treated as a Druid 5.
A Cavalier 1/Fighter 8 would be treated as a Druid 5.
